One thing I've had bit me is the lack of some sort of confirmation, see this example.
I have a objective-c method in a library like so: - (void)observe:(CallbackBlock)block; The CallbackBlock is a type def-ed block like so: typedef void (^CallbackBlock)(FDataSnapshot *snapshot); The parameter in the block gets converted into a IUO, I ended up releasing an app that crashed due to that IUO being nil. The code that crashed was something like this object.observe { $0.doSomething() } There is no way to tell that the $0 was a IUO. The compiler didn't force me to confirm in it in some way using a ! and unless I remembered to check the header I would have a crash.
